Host destination Macao counts Jade Dragon, rising eight places to No.27, and Wing Lei Palace debuting at No.36. Individual Country Awards: JapanJapan leads the 2019 list with 12 entries while Den (No.3) earns the title of The Best Restaurant in Japan for a second consecutive year. Entering the list at No.16, Greater China Ultraviolet by Paul Pairet (No.6) in Shanghai is named The Best Restaurant in China. Hong Kong counts nine restaurants, including first-time entries Vea (No.34) and Seventh Son (No.44). Soaring 25 places to No.15, modern French bistro Belon is crowned with this year’s Highest Climber Award. Ascending 11 places to No.7, Mume in Taipei clinches the title of The Best Restaurant in Taiwan, besting two-time winner, Raw (No.30). RegionalLocavore (No.42) in Bali holds the title of The Best Restaurant in Indonesia and wins the Sustainable Restaurant Award in Asia, presented to the restaurant with the highest environmental and social responsibility rating, as determined by audit partner Food Made Good. Indian Accent (No. 17) returns as The Best Restaurant in India for a fifth successive year.
